Why Hiring a Professional Installer Matters

Setting up a back entrance includes more than simply hanging the door. The procedure includes determining, framing, and insulating properly to avoid drafts and energy loss. Professional installers bring important experience and skills to ensure the job is done right. Here are some essential advantages of employing a professional:

  • Expertise: Professionals comprehend the complexities involved in door installation, consisting of alignment, leveling, and sealing.
  • Tools and Equipment: They come geared up with specialized tools, which can conserve homeowners from purchasing expensive gear they may not utilize typically.
  • Time Efficiency: Skilled installers can finish the task faster, minimizing interruption to daily life.
  • Service warranty: Many professionals provide warranties on their craftsmanship, offering assurance for property owners.

What to Look for When Hiring Back Door Installers

Choosing the ideal installer is vital to making sure a successful installation. Here are some necessary factors to consider:

  1. Experience and Specialization:

    • Look for installers who concentrate on door setups and have a wealth of experience.
    • Examine their portfolio for examples of previous work.
  2. Licensing and Insurance:

    • Ensure that the installer is licensed and carries liability insurance. This protects homeowners in case of accidents or damages during the installation.
  3. Client Reviews and References:

    • Read online reviews and demand recommendations to gauge the quality of their work.
    • Look for reviews that highlight reliability and professionalism.
  4. Composed Estimate:

    • Obtain a detailed, written estimate that includes labor costs, materials, and any extra costs.
    • Transparency in rates is essential to avoid unforeseen expenditures.
  5. Warranty:

Average Cost of Back Door Installation

The cost of employing a professional installer for a back door can vary significantly based upon several factors, including the kind of door, the complexity of the installation, and geographical area. Below is a breakdown of typical costs:

  1. Door Type:

    • Basic steel or fiberglass door: ₤ 300 - ₤ 800
    • Wood doors: ₤ 800 - ₤ 2,500
    • Custom doors: ₤ 2,500 and up
  2. Installation Costs:

    • Labor: ₤ 100 - ₤ 500 depending on complexity and area
    • Additional products (hardware, trim, and so on): ₤ 50 - ₤ 300
  3. Disposal Fees:

    • Old door disposal may sustain extra expenses, normally varying from ₤ 25 - ₤ 100.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. For how long does it take to set up a back entrance?

The majority of back door setups take in between 2 to 6 hours, depending on the intricacy of the job and any needed structural modifications.

2. Can I set up a back entrance myself?

While some homeowners may have the abilities to do so, it is usually advised to hire a professional to ensure an appropriate fit and seal, which reduces the risk of energy loss and enhances security.

3. What should I do to prepare for the installation?

Prior to installation, clear the area around the back door and make sure the installer has access to required tools and equipment. Talk about any specific requirements or concerns with your installer ahead of time.

4. What kinds of back doors are readily available?

Back entrances come in various styles, consisting of sliding doors, French doors, and traditional hinged doors. The choice depends on individual preference, space, and functionality.

5. Do back entrance installers use custom services?

Many installers do supply custom alternatives based upon individual choices. If you have specific requirements or styles in mind, it is a good idea to discuss these throughout the preliminary consultation.
